not only that, but inoki brought in real mma wrestlers and had them win titles, most were god awful and inoki himself even put himself in some of the earlier matches to stroke his ego, but those were when they were work mma matches that sucked. the MMA wrestlers that became IWGP champions lwere Tadao Yasuda, Kazuyuki Fujita, and Bob Sapp. The former of two are not brought up during the parade of champions videos. Fujita's matches aren't even on NJPW World.
